What is fluoride?

Fluoride is a mineral that absorbs into tooth enamel to strengthen the outer surface of your teeth.

When should I use mouthwash?

Use mouthwash 1-2 times daily as directed. Swish for about a minute, spit it out and wait 30 minutes before eating.

How do I use ACT Kids Anticavity Mouthwash correctly?

Use the integrated dosing cap to measure 10 mL (the cap's fill line). Have your child swish vigorously for one full minute, then spit it out. Do not eat, drink, or rinse with water for 30 minutes afterward. Use once daily after brushing, preferably at bedtime.

Should my child use this before or after brushing their teeth?

Use ACT Kids after brushing. Brushing first removes plaque and food debris, allowing the fluoride rinse to contact clean enamel surfaces for maximum absorption. The one-minute swish should be the final step before bedtime.
